The following documents are usually expected in Chemnitz for a naturalisation under § 10 StAG. The specific list may vary from case to case — family applications require additional annexes for each person.
- Valid passport (biometric) — present all of them in case of multiple nationalities
- Residence title with evidence of at least 5 years of lawful residence
- B1 language certificate (telc, Goethe, ÖSD or DTZ) or a recognised alternative
- Naturalisation test certificate with at least 17 out of 33 points
- Proof of income for the past 12 months
- Certificate of good conduct from the German Federal Central Criminal Register
- Birth certificate with apostille and certified translation
- Marriage certificate with apostille (if married)
- Extended registration certificate to triangulate your residence history
- Tabular CV with a gapless residence history

Processing time according to a press report: rund 18 Monate, bis ein Antrag erstmals bearbeitet wird; danach Bearbeitungszeiten von drei Monaten bis zu einem Jahr(press, quoting the authority)
Source: Radio Chemnitz (zitiert Antwort der Stadt Chemnitz auf Stadtratsanfrage der Linksfraktion) · As at: 2025-06-27
Authority's own assessment
Laut Stadt Chemnitz (Stand Juni 2025, Antwort auf eine Stadtratsanfrage) vergehen aktuell rund 18 Monate, bis ein Einbürgerungsantrag erstmals bearbeitet wird; die anschliessende Bearbeitung dauert dann drei Monate bis zu einem Jahr - real also bis zu rund zwei Jahre insgesamt. Als Gründe nennt die Verwaltung die hohe Antragszahl (Ende Mai 2025: 2.421 offene Anträge) und begrenzte Personalkapazitäten (5,7 von 6,8 Stellen besetzt); die konkrete Dauer hängt vom Einzelfall ab.

02Which requirements must I meet for naturalization?
For naturalization under § 10 StAG you generally need five years of lawful residence, a secure livelihood, German at B1 level, a passed Einbürgerungstest (citizenship test) and a commitment to the free democratic basic order. A clean criminal record is checked as well.
03Which documents do I need for naturalization in Chemnitz?
Typically a passport, residence permit, B1 language certificate, Einbürgerungstest certificate, proof of income for the last twelve months, a police clearance certificate plus birth and, if applicable, marriage certificates with translation. Civitas. builds a complete checklist for your case.
